Dodwell Park offers a convenient location for visiting Stratford-upon-Avon, with a bus stop right outside. Guests frequently praise the friendly and helpful staff. While the site is generally clean and tidy, some visitors note that the toilet and shower facilities are dated and could benefit from an update. Pitches are often described as sloping, requiring levelling blocks. The dog walking field is a popular feature. Some reviewers mention pitches being close together.
